Transaction e3015907bb62fe6739570fdd1cb1db1af96dab9de02aa45a92700727dbe67803
1 Input
1 Output
-
e3015907bb62fe6739570fdd1cb1db1af96dab9de02aa45a92700727dbe67803:0
- value
- 99997083
- script pubkey
- OP_0 OP_PUSHBYTES_20 38e139fbbc8032466c077079875216be2eeeaefb
- address
- bc1q8rsnn7ausqeyvmq8wpucw5skhchwathm97l294